The 23rd day of the twelfth lunar month is the day when every household in Shengjiatun goes to heaven to report on the daily life of the family. The Kitchen God is also called the Kitchen God. Everyone has to eat, and every household has a stove. Where there is a stove, there is a Kitchen God. According to the saying passed down from generation to generation by the older generation, the Kitchen God is the family protector sent by the Jade Emperor to the human world, and at the same time monitors the good and evil of the family's daily behavior. At dusk on the day of the Kitchen God farewell, the Kitchen God of each family must go to the Heavenly Court to report on the family's actions in the past year. After listening to the report, the Jade Emperor will determine the good and bad fortune of the family in the next year. Therefore, the report of the Kitchen God is very important to every household, and the Kitchen God farewell ceremony is indispensable for every household.

There is a table in front of the portrait, which is the offering table. On it are dumplings, fruits, sugar melons, and white wine. Sugar melons are similar to modern maltose, which is sticky and sweet. Its function is to sweeten the mouth of the Kitchen God so that he can only say sweet words when he reports to the Jade Emperor after he goes to heaven. In the middle of the edge of the table, there is an incense burner with three incense sticks lit in it.
Xiaolan's family was quite particular. Shengxuan even made a pony out of straw and blessed it with a needle. He placed wheat bran and chopped grass feed in front of the horse, meaning that after the horse was full, the Kitchen God would ride on it to heaven.
When bidding farewell to the Kitchen God, a string of firecrackers should be set off, offerings should be picked up with chopsticks for the Kitchen God to eat, and wine should be poured into the incense burner, which is a symbolic toast to the Kitchen God. The next morning, Xiaolan's family started sweeping the house. As the saying goes, the house should be dusted and swept on the 24th day of the twelfth lunar month. In fact, the house can be swept from the 23rd day of the twelfth lunar month to New Year's Eve, but many people do it on the 24th day of the twelfth lunar month.
This year, Xin and Zhang Shanfeng lived in Xiaolan's house, so they paid more attention to these rituals and rules. Cleaning up the dust and debris at home on this day symbolizes driving away the bad luck and bad luck of the old year and welcoming the good luck and happiness of the new year. "Chen" and "Chen" are homophones, so sweeping the dust is sweeping the old, which symbolizes sweeping out the misfortunes and negative emotions of the old year. This is what Xin told Xiaolan.
